Output f8c20a8be643f48a73502ab18b784cdd3c12103cbcd6b8ccf6eb6a6025da0f33:0

value
2520967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d28e822f2e435731ceea96ee233e1dcfc0b5b0 OP_EQUAL
address
3KT9FVYqJP4idGwax3tPfYSCRyjubLH2H7
transaction
f8c20a8be643f48a73502ab18b784cdd3c12103cbcd6b8ccf6eb6a6025da0f33
spent
true